Laziness is often a symptom of something more significant, like depression or anxiety, and it should not be something we judge harshly. When we take a closer look, the concept of ...It persists for more than two weeks, and it impacts multiple areas of a person's life. Depression is often marked by ongoing feelings of sadness, hopelessness, apathy, fatigue, a fixation on past failures or self-blame, as well as thoughts of death and suicide. It is not uncommon for people with depression to think they are being "lazy" or to ...Nov 28, 2022 · Emotional signs include feelings of despair, dread, anxiety, cynicism, emotional exhaustion, mental exhaustion, and depression. Every individual is unique, so symptoms may vary. Every individual ... So the basic difference lies in the fact that depression is not chosen. With depression, the person might want to get out of it. However, laziness is not the same. Laziness is no mental health disorder, it is just a choice a mere habit that makes us procrastinate and delay things. Being lazy isn’t a criminal offense.

Symptoms of anxiety ...Feb 10, 2020 · However, common symptoms, which also make up the diagnostic criteria for major depressive disorder, are as follows: Feelings of intense sadness, despair, and/or emptiness. Loss of pleasure in activities you used to enjoy. Significant changes in appetite or weight. Sleep disruption, such as insomnia or hypersomnia. I feel under an unpleasant level of pressure ... lacking confidence crossword Apr 24, 2024 · Researchers Ghanean et al. found that over 90 percent of people with depression suffer from fatigue. Exhaustion makes people unable to do certain things. Laziness, in contrast, makes people unwilling to do things. Depression causes fatigue by negatively affecting certain neurotransmitters in the brain. Here’s what they shared with us: 1.
